WebFeb 20, 2024 · If something makes you excited, you can say that it sets your pulse racing: This young actor is setting pulses racing all over the world. In much more informal language, stoked and buzzing are common words for ‘excited’: Daisy was stoked to be invited. When we arrived in New York, I was just buzzing.
